Hilton Worldwide and Constructora Colpatria have signed a franchise license agreement to open Hilton Medellin, bringing the company’s flagship brand to Colombia’s second largest city. The new-build development is planned to open in Q2 2019.

Hilton opened DoubleTree Bogota Calle 100, Hampton by Hilton Bucaramanga, and Hampton Inn by Hilton Medellin in Colombia in 2016. It currently has a portfolio of 14 properties in the country and nine projects in the pipeline.
Hilton Medellin
The 25-storey property will be located on Avenida de las Palmas, a main road in the city’s upscale El Poblado neighbourhood. It will be part of a mixed-use development, combining retail, office space and non-branded residential units. Features and amenities will include:
- 21,000+ square feet of meeting and event space comprised of a 6500-square-foot modular ballroom and five meeting rooms
- 206 guestrooms
- outdoor pool and whirlpool
- executive lounge
- fitness centre
- restaurant and piano bar
- spa and beauty salon
The hotel is owned and developed by Constructora Colpatria, a company with more than 40 years experience in the Colombian market.
